    Supervisor Weishan SUBMITTED the following Amendment to Item 17, File No. 07-71: MODIFY the WHEREAS clause beginning on line 24 as follows: WHEREAS, the high-level analysis that has been conducted to date, as well as progress made on broad lease/sale negotiations, has led the Directors of DHHS and ECD to tentatively conclude that a lease or purchase of the St. Michael property – coupled with the sale of the property currently occupied by BHD – could provide a vastly improved location for BHD inpatient and long-term care operations and generate significant annual overhead savings that could be utilized to enhance those operations; and WHEREAS, this action also holds potential to allow the County to consolidate other activities at the St. Michael location, which could produce fiscal and programmatic benefits for other County departments; and WHEREAS, a final recommendation to pursue this course of action cannot be made without additional engineering and environmental analysis of the St. Michael building and property, additional architectural analysis to better estimate the cost of necessary building renovations and outside legal assistance to negotiate a final lease or sale agreement; and WHEREAS, consequently, the Directors of DHHS and ECD are seeking authorization from the County Board to make expenditures on the items listed above in an amount not to exceed $200,000 so that they can negotiate a lease or sale agreement with WFH and provide policymakers with the information they need to determine whether such an agreement is in the best interest of Milwaukee County; and DELETE the WHEREAS clause beginning on line 73 as follows: WHEREAS, the Directors of DHHS and ECD have been involved in preliminary negotiations with WFH, and the agreement currently under consideration would consist of the following general elements: 1. The County would acquire the entire St. Michael property and adjacent professional office building under a purchase agreement or long-term lease ending in full County ownership. The space used for operation of the Family Care Center would be excluded from a lease or, under a purchase scenario, leased back to WFH for only the cost of utilities and other direct costs associated with its operation.

  • 2007) - 27 - (February 1

    2. Under a long-term lease agreement, the annual rent for BHD’s occupation of the leased premises would be $1.00. The County would be required to pay WFH fair market value for any space occupied by the County above the estimated 365,000 square feet needed by BHD, and the County would be responsible for providing WFH any revenue received through lease of the premises to third parties. In addition, the County would provide WFH with a payment of between $3 million and $6 million (the precise amount would be subject to additional negotiation) over a multi-year time period to cover costs associated with relocating WFH outpatient services currently located at St. Michael. 3. Under a sale agreement, the County would purchase the property for a price of between $4.5 million and $7.5 million, with the precise payment amount and payment terms subject to additional negotiation. The property would be sold or leased by WFH to the County in an “as is” condition and the County would assume responsibility for all major maintenance or repair and any liability related to the premises. The County would seek a catastrophic protection clause for mechanicals in the building for a mutually determined period of time. MODIFY the BE IT RESOLVED CLAUSE on line 105 as follows: BE IT RESOLVED, that the County Board of Supervisors hereby authorizes the Directors of DHHS and ECD to spend up to $200,000 for additional engineering and environmental analysis of the St. Michael building and property, additional architectural analysis to better estimate the cost of necessary building renovations to house BHD, and outside legal assistance to carry out the intent of this Resolution; and
